The discussion regarding having a good diet which can aid a good memory has long been debated much over the years. Plus as technology changes, we are realizing more than ever before about how exactly what we consume affects our systems. The loss of memory frequently associated with older ages is something that most societies of the world can say they've in common. Nevertheless what's being discovered is that most of what we consume could be a cause of memory loss in the future.
A 2008 study executed by researchers from the Medical University of South Carolina stated that residents living in advanced developed nations suffered the most from memory loss. Interestingly, it was stated that these nations were those having diets which were the highest in saturated fat as well as cholesterol. Research in 2 universities stated that memory impairment was the result from a diet high in these ingredients.
When the same thing happen in humans, it may be advised, according to the study that the reduction of cholesterol and fats within the diet might help to improve brain performance and also keep memory.
The Function of Super Foods
It is been discovered that a number of foods can be helpful in the slowing down of cognitive decline that's related to age. One of those numerous foods is definitely berries. And incorporating them into your daily diet is easier than you may think.
The same holds true for all those veggies having dark green leafy qualities. Veggies of this type include green spinach and also romaine lettuce, and all it requires is usually to create a salad having your nightly meal. In fact, a salad could be incorporated with any meal as well as as a healthy snack when you include berries and nuts to it. Even just one cup of spinach can provide you with fifteen percent of one's daily Vit. E requirement.
Essential fatty acids, including those seen in fish such as salmon have numerous properties which help the brain. They are classified as 'essential' because they could only be acquired by eating fish which contain them or perhaps by taking dietary supplements.
Memory-Reducing Foods to prevent
Soda is really something which numerous specialists say we should avoid entirely. This is due to the amounts of glucose it contains. In order to function correctly, the brain requires glucose, however in a steady stream. The amount of glucose delivered in one sitting can be overwhelming for both the human brain and the entire body to process at once.
As stated earlier, fast foods are generally full of both bad cholesterol and saturated fat, which imply they can threaten our memory in the future. This occurs because the high-fat content in fast foods causes carotid artery disease, which is a narrowing of arteries within the neck. This may lead to less oxygen reaching the brain, which will eventually impair memory function.
A Rare Food Which Helps Memory
Numerous studies have shown that the simple action of chewing gum can help with both short and also long-term memory, whether the gum contains sugar or otherwise not. This has led some experts to think that it's the rise in heart rate that accompanies gum-chewing which, consequently, increases blood flow to the brain.
Noticeably students who spend time chewing gum during study achieved better grades compared to their non chewing class mates. While there's no scientific evidence to prove this, the results have caused interesting debate.
